Episode description

The Cubs are still in the conversation in the World Series as Dusty Baker makes reference to his Cubs teams. Are Cubs fans still upset about the 2003 Cubs? David Kaplan, Gordon Wittenmyer, and Tim Stebbins discuss Dusty's 2003 Cubs team and compares that team and his work on that team to the current Astros. Later in the podcast, the guys break down some potential harsh truths about the upcoming contract negotiations between the players and owners that could eventually lead to a work stoppage and how that would impact the Cubs offseason.
